Meet Mayerly, a kind and loving girl who grows up in a rural community in the department of Cochabamba, located in the central region of Bolivia. The community where Mayerly lives with her parents and three siblings is characterized by agriculture as its main economic activity. She and her entire family live in a humble house with brick walls, a metal roof, and a cement floor. Their home has electricity and running water but lacks indoor sanitation. Her father works as a bricklayer, while her mother does housework and farms for domestic consumption. Her father earns approximately US $ 285.00 which is insufficient to cover the needs of his large family. Mayerly attends public elementary school in her community, and her favorite subject is math. While at home, she enjoys her free time playing with her dolls and also helping her mom in the kitchen. Mayerly really enjoys her time at school, which motivates her to dream of becoming a teacher when she grows up.
